Brief Summary

The investigators hypothesize that inactivity during the search for a donor may exacerbate current deconditioned states; subsequently, influencing risk factors for post-transplant complications that hinder the recovery phase. This study is designed to investigate if exercise therapy administered prior to allogeneic hematologic stem cell transplantation (HSCT) can influence physical and psychological side-effects associated with HSCT. Approximately 6-weeks prior to HSCT, individuals will be randomized into either an exercise group or usual care group and followed until one year after HSCT.

Study Arms (2)

Exercise

EXPERIMENTAL

Individuals will participate in weekly supervised and unsupervised exercise sessions prior to HSCT, during hospitalization and till 100 days from HSCT. Exercise will consist of endurance and resistance exercise 3-5 days a week.

Behavioral: Exercise

Usual Care

NO INTERVENTION

Usual care will have continue with standard of care treatment without any specific exercise instruction or guidance other than what is provided by the patient education team at the cancer centre.

Eligibility Criteria

Age17 Years+
Sexall
Healthy VolunteersNo
Age GroupsChild (0-17), Adult (18-64), Older Adult (65+)

You may qualify if:

  • Medical indication: allogeneic stem cell transplantation at Princess Margaret Hospital
  • must be ambulatory without need for human assistance at time of recruitment
  • medically cleared to exercise by the transplant physician
  • demonstrates willingness to attend supervised sessions
  • sufficient in English to ensure safety of understanding prescribed exercise guidelines, or has access to an adequate non-familial interpreter

You may not qualify if:

  • another active malignancy
  • less than 4 weeks till the scheduled HSCT
  • refusal to be randomized
  • does not have the approval of their transplant physician
  • severe or unstable neurological, cardiorespiratory, musculoskeletal disease or mental illness
